Dallmeier partners with White Oak UK for vendor finance programme

White Oak UK, one of the UK’s largest alternative providers of SME finance, and Dallmeier, a supplier of network-based video surveillance systems, have announced a new partnership aimed at offering finance solutions to Dallmeier UK business customers.

White Oak UK’s vendor finance programme will allow Dallmeier to provide solutions to those customers that do not have access to up-front capital. The partnership is in direct response to customer requests and feedback for such a scheme.

James Walker, Managing Director at Dallmeier UK, said, “we are dedicated to developing cutting-edge, reliable and cost-efficient video monitoring solutions for a wide range of applications. We believe that our partnership with White Oak UK demonstrates our commitment to providing affordable solutions for our business customers. White Oak UK’s professional service and competitive solution complement our trading philosophies, which made our decision to partner with them straightforward.”

White Oak UK’s solution provides Dallmeier customers with a complete end-to-end project management solution. Through the approved integration partner scheme, customers are now able to deal with Dallmeier directly, from system design, to installation and maintenance.

Walker continued by saying, “we believe the partnership may also lead to an increase in sales opportunities, with customers that may have previously shied away from purchasing a leading Dallmeier solution based solely on price perception. We feel that a revenue-based finance option will shorten our sales cycles and enable easier cost-benefit purchasing decisions to be made”.

Rob Hulse, Head of Channel Development at White Oak UK added, “we are excited to work alongside Dallmeier and provide them with a range of flexible finance solutions to help them increase orders and improve their cash flow. Most importantly, the partnership will offer their customers, who have indicated a strong demand for leasing options, to acquire Dallmeier’s leading surveillance systems in a financially manageable way”.

This is the second global brand to secure a finance partnership with White Oak UK in the last three months, having signed on ASSA ABLOY earlier this year.
